Miffy and Friends: Outdoor Adventures (US/CA) is an animated children's television show that follows the lovable bunny Miffy and her group of animal friends as they embark on exciting outdoor adventures. Season 2 episode 10, titled "Miffy Plants a Seed/Snuffy's Doghouse," is an adorable and educational installment of the series that teaches valuable life lessons to young viewers.
In the first part of the episode, "Miffy Plants a Seed," Miffy discovers her newfound love for gardening. Inspired by her grandma, who has a beautiful flower garden, Miffy decides to try her hand at planting seeds of her own. With the help of her friends, Melanie the monkey and Grunty the pig, the enthusiastic bunny embarks on a journey to learn all about gardening and cultivate her green thumb.
Miffy, armed with a small shovel and a big heart full of determination, starts by preparing the soil for her seeds. She learns the importance of loosening the earth and removing any rocks or weeds that may hinder plant growth. The episode showcases how Miffy carefully digs small holes with her shovel, ensuring that each seed has enough space to grow. Young viewers will be captivated as they witness Miffy's patience and attentiveness throughout the process.
As Miffy plants her seeds, she discovers the significance of watering them regularly. With a small watering can in hand, she gently quenches her seeds' thirst, understanding that they need water to sprout and flourish. Through Miffy's delightful adventures in the garden, children will learn about the essentials of gardening, including the importance of sunlight, water, and proper care to help plants thrive.
In the second part of the episode, "Snuffy's Doghouse," Miffy's best friend Snuffy the dog encounters a dilemma. Snuffy's old doghouse has become worn-out and no longer provides the comfort and shelter he needs. Determined to lend a helping hand, Miffy and her pals decide to embark on a DIY project to build Snuffy a brand-new doghouse.
Together, the group brainstorms and gathers materials for the construction process. Miffy leads the way, ensuring everyone's safety and encouraging teamwork as they work towards their common goal. Young viewers will be inspired by Miffy's leadership and problem-solving skills as she guides her friends through the building process.
The episode takes young viewers through each step of constructing Snuffy's new doghouse, showcasing the use of tools such as hammers, nails, and saws in a child-friendly manner. Miffy and her friends demonstrate the importance of measuring, cutting, and assembling the pieces of wood to create a sturdy and cozy shelter for Snuffy. Throughout the construction process, the show emphasizes the values of cooperation, creativity, and perseverance.
As the doghouse nears completion, the characters decorate it with colorful paints, making it a vibrant and personalized space for Snuffy. Through this activity, the episode encourages children to express their creativity and make things uniquely their own. Ultimately, Miffy and her friends succeed in building a doghouse that Snuffy adores, creating a heartwarming moment of joy and accomplishment.
